About Mouloud Tribeche

Mouloud Tribeche is a scholar working on Geophysics, Astronomy and Astrophysics and Atomic and Molecular Physics, and Optics, having authored 174 papers that have together received 4.2k indexed citations. Recurring topics across this work include Dust and Plasma Wave Phenomena (155 papers), Ionosphere and magnetosphere dynamics (105 papers) and Earthquake Detection and Analysis (82 papers). The work is most often cited by research in Geophysics (2.2k citations), Astronomy and Astrophysics (2.6k citations) and Atomic and Molecular Physics, and Optics (3.8k citations). Mouloud Tribeche has collaborated with scholars based in Algeria, Iran and India. Frequent co-authors include Rabia Amour, Leila Ait Gougam, P. K. Shukla, Taha Houssine Zerguini, Kamel Ourabah, М. Shahmansouri, A. S. Bains, Tarsem Singh Gill, Hamid Reza Pakzad and Biswajit Sahu. Their work appears in journals such as Physics Letters A, Annals of Physics and Neural Networks.
